Output ddb5ac61131a120f6873b4b9f7d2221c9ed337ccedcadde4c90a1a9e7f2e2d26:1

value
31834000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59740155238a9b65398a64839e47e514dce75d1 OP_EQUAL
address
3JFBRKd8FUrCAnPVmDiEqqXeu1JeYYyqQ3
transaction
ddb5ac61131a120f6873b4b9f7d2221c9ed337ccedcadde4c90a1a9e7f2e2d26
spent
true